Fiber reinforced refractory castables for SPF toolings [PDF]

open access: yesMaterialwissenschaft und Werkstofftechnik, 2008
AbstractFiber reinforced refractory castable (FRRC) is an emerging material solution to manufacture SPF tools for forming titanium alloy sheets. Indeed, FRRC are able to conserve good mechanical properties up to 900 °C. Fiber reinforcement allows to improve mechanical properties and to avoid a catastrophic failure.
